In one of the blogs I read, I discovered The Fiber Denn and their herbal moth away products. I purchased the “Sextet Collection ” which contained 6 different blends to scare away these voracious insects.

They include some small heat-sealable teabags and a small wooden scoop to make your sachets.

At Rhinebeck I also purchased some bulk herbs — a mix of cedar, rosemary, mint — from an unknown vendor (no name on the receipt, no card in the bag or I would link to them, really!). I already had some large heat-sealable teabags and I put this blend in those. If you want teabags of your own, I bought mine from Atlantic Spice Company. They have herbs too if you want to blend your own.
So here’s hoping that I have put a stop to those moths! Luckily of all the sweaters I had tucked away waiting to be finished, this was the only one they found appetizing (the others are wool too). All my stash is stored in plastic bins in other rooms, and I do go through them every month. These sachets will make me feel better!
